what are the differences between a plant and animal cell?

Respuesta :

MyriamManve MyriamManve
  • 18-12-2019

Answer:

Plant cells contain chloroplasts since they need to perform photosynthesis, but animal cells do not.

Explanation:

animal cells do not have a cell wall or chloroplasts but plant cells do. Animal cells are mostly round and irregular in shape while plant cells have fixed, rectangular shapes.
